Responsibilities
Manage and oversee general ledger accounting, ensuring accuracy and completeness of all financial data.
Prepare, analyze, and review financial statements in accordance with GAAP (Generally Accepted Accounting Principles), IFRS (International Financial Reporting Standards), and other regulatory requirements.
Conduct balance sheet reconciliations and account analysis to identify discrepancies and implement corrective actions.
Lead month-end and year-end closing processes, including journal entries, accruals, and adjustments.
Ensure compliance with SOX (Sarbanes-Oxley Act) controls and assist with internal audits related to financial reporting.
Support budgeting, forecasting, and financial planning activities through detailed analysis and reporting.
Manage accounts payable and accounts receivable processes, including vendor payments, collections, and cash management strategies.
Utilize accounting software such as QuickBooks, Sage, Xero, or similar platforms to streamline operations and enhance reporting accuracy.
Prepare regulatory reports and assist with external audits by providing necessary documentation and explanations.
Perform technical accounting research on complex transactions involving non-profit accounting, governmental accounting, or other specialized areas as needed.
